[OSM-dev-fr] osmfr-cartocss setup incomprehensible

Ista Pouss istaous at gmail.com
Ven 24 Mai 13:55:53 UTC 2013


Ça y est, j'ai exécuté toutes tes commandes impecable, mais ça n'a rien
changé pour
l'osm2pgsql !

/home/herve> osm2pgsql -s -U fr -d osm datas1.osm
osm2pgsql SVN version 0.80.0 (32bit id space)

Using projection SRS 900913 (Spherical Mercator)
Setting up table: planet_osm_point
NOTICE:  table "planet_osm_point" does not exist, skipping
NOTICE:  table "planet_osm_point_tmp" does not exist, skipping
SELECT AddGeometryColumn('planet_osm_point', 'way', 900913, 'POINT', 2 );
 failed: ERROR:  AddGeometryColumns() - invalid SRID
CONTEXT:  SQL statement "SELECT AddGeometryColumn('','',$1,$2,$3,$4,$5)"
PL/pgSQL function "addgeometrycolumn" line 5 at SQL statement



Le 24 mai 2013 15:24, Arnaud Vandecasteele <arnaud.sig at gmail.com> a écrit :

>  Ben le path vers postgis.sql :)
>
> Tu peux faire un "locate postgis.sql" pour trouver ton fichier.
> Le mien est dans  :
> /usr/share/postgresql/9.1/contrib/postgis-2.0/postgis.sql
>
> Pour le plpgsql, il devait être installé dans ton template d'origine.
>
> A.
>
>
>
> On 13-05-24 10:50 AM, Ista Pouss wrote:
>
> Hoooo grand sorcier tout se passe bien, mais...
>
>
> Le 24 mai 2013 14:22, Arnaud Vandecasteele <arnaud.sig at gmail.com> a écrit
> :
>
>>
>> Ensuite le mieux c'est de te faire un template géographique (une sorte de
>> base de données qui servira de modèle).
>> Puis tu utilises celle-la pour chaque nouvelle base de données
>> géographiques :
>>
>> createdb -E UTF8 template_postgis
>> createlang -d template_postgis plpgsql
>> psql -d postgres -c "UPDATE pg_database SET datistemplate='true' WHERE datname='template_postgis';"
>> psql -d template_postgis -f $POSTGIS_SQL_PATH/postgis.sql
>>
>>  $ psql -d template_postgis -f $POSTGIS_SQL_PATH/postgis.sql
> /postgis.sql: Aucun fichier ou dossier de ce type
>
>  ... c'est à cause que $POSTGIS_SQL_PATH n'existe pas sur mon poste
> j'imagine, mais quelle valeur faut-il lui donner ?
>
>
>  J'ai également eu une petite péripétie :
>
> $ createlang -d template_postgis plpgsql
> createlang: language "plpgsql" is already installed in database
> "template_postgis"
>
>  ... j'imagine que c'est un reliquat d'ailleurs.
>
>  Merci en tous les cas.
>
>
>
>>  psql -d template_postgis -f $POSTGIS_SQL_PATH/spatial_ref_sys.sql
>> psql -d template_postgis -c "GRANT ALL ON geometry_columns TO PUBLIC;"
>> psql -d template_postgis -c "GRANT ALL ON geography_columns TO PUBLIC;"
>> psql -d template_postgis -c "GRANT ALL ON spatial_ref_sys TO PUBLIC;"
>>
>>
>>  A.
>>
>>
>>
>
> _______________________________________________
> dev-fr mailing listdev-fr at openstreetmap.orghttp://lists.openstreetmap.org/listinfo/dev-fr
>
>
> --
> --------------------------------------------------------------------
> Arnaud Vandecasteele
> SIG - WebMapping - Spatial Ontology - GeoCollaboration
>
> Web Sitehttp://geotribu.net/
>
>
> _______________________________________________
> dev-fr mailing list
> dev-fr at openstreetmap.org
> http://lists.openstreetmap.org/listinfo/dev-fr
>
>


-- 
Les dérives de rue :
Profession émotion <http://drivrsdu.fr/profession-emotion/>
-------------- section suivante --------------
Une pièce jointe HTML a été nettoyée...
URL: <http://lists.openstreetmap.org/pipermail/dev-fr/attachments/20130524/385e2289/attachment.html>


Plus d'informations sur la liste de diffusion dev-fr